TS Galaxy Part Ways With Adnan Beganovic as Bernard Parker Steps In During Critical Season Run-In

TS Galaxy have made a major leadership change after confirming the departure of head coach Adnan Beganovic following a difficult run of results in the Betway Premiership. The decision comes at a sensitive stage of the season when the club is still competing for strong league positioning and preparing for a cup final. Despite the coaching exit, the club has moved swiftly to ensure continuity by appointing club legend Bernard Parker in an interim role. Parker, a respected figure in South African football, is expected to guide the team through the final stretch of the season. His immediate focus will include stabilising league performances and preparing the squad for the upcoming Nedbank Cup Final. Reports suggest his appointment has been welcomed by the players, who see him as a familiar and influential presence. His leadership is viewed internally as a potential stabilising force during a challenging period.

There is also recognition within the club that Beganovic contributed positively during his tenure, particularly in cup competition success that helped TS Galaxy reach a major final. While league form remained inconsistent, his role in cup progression is being acknowledged by the club. The decision to part ways is therefore being framed as a tactical adjustment rather than a dismissal of his overall contribution.
